On Mon, 02 Sep 2013 07:36:12 -0600, slide wrote:
An iPhone or Galaxy can display GPS data when out of range of a cell tower? === Absolutely, right in mid-ocean. Most smart phones have a built in GPS receiver these days, and there are some very decent charting packages available. For about $25 to Navionics I have a full set of US and Caribbean charts on my Galaxy along with a fairly decent little plotting application. You don't even need a cell phone account to do all that, a WiFi connection will suffice. |
